How does Marshall, NC compare to Pleasant Hill, NC? Marshall has a population of 846 with a median household income of $53,125, while Pleasant Hill has 849 residents and a median income of $67,768.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Marshall, NC | Pleasant Hill, NC |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 846 | 849 | -0.4% |
| Median Age | 46.7 | 56.7 | -17.6% |
| Foreign Born % | 0% | 0% | — |
| Metric | Marshall | Pleasant Hill |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$53,125 | $67,768 | -21.6% |
| Unemployment | 0% | 0% | — |
| Poverty Rate | 20.9% | 8.5% | +145.9% |
| Bachelor's+ | 39.4% | 15.1% | +160.9% |
| Metric | Marshall | Pleasant Hill |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$242,600 | $147,500 | +64.5% |
